Transaction 72fbce7e67d6cb7e016b2414d70092e79ae4ab7b3678152169bebf27a0f87944
1 Input
2 Outputs
- 72fbce7e67d6cb7e016b2414d70092e79ae4ab7b3678152169bebf27a0f87944:0
- 72fbce7e67d6cb7e016b2414d70092e79ae4ab7b3678152169bebf27a0f87944:1
value 27096774
address 3KGeA4Xcc69PGA7HvpME8sSRoGsfiZLT5F
value 83447736
address 1D6HvVsELnTE65jf6KSYNDA1Ap5w8pbWXP